#e55280 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e55280 is composed of 89.8% red, 32.2%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 64.2% magenta, 44.1%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 341.2 degrees, a saturation of 73.9% and a lightness of 61%. #e55280 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a4ff with #cb0001.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

Shades and Tints of #e55280

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0206 is the darkest color, while #fffd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#e55280

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a0979a is the less saturated color, while #fc3b77 is the most saturated one.
